California, California, Great Yarmouth, NR29 3PDCalifornia, Great Yarmouth
California Beach near Great Yarmouth is a lovely, wide, sand and shingle beach at the bottom of low sandy cliffs, merging with Scratby Beach.
Peaceful and picturesque part of the coastline accessed via steep steps.

Nr. Berney Arms Railway Station, Great Yarmouth, Norfolk, NR31 4PZTelephone
01603 715191Great Yarmouth
Berney Marshes alongside the Breydon Water estuary in Great Yarmouth is a wonderfully unspoilt RSPB nature reserve. Experience the spectacle of the tens of thousands of wintering birds that visit the estuary and surrounding grazing marshes.
